The problem is that if it's not a clean-room/Chinese wall reimplementation, then it isn't Free Software regardless of what license they try to slap on it. In order for a Free Software license to be valid the person choosing the license has to be the copyright holder to begin with, and if it's a derivative work of the proprietary original -- which it is, if it's created by feeding the original into an AI -- then they aren't!
